Overview
This Penrith hotel is situated within a 10-minute stroll of Penrith Railway Station. It is located a short walk from Penrith F.C. and Penrith Castle.
This 3.5-star hotel provides meeting rooms, free Wi-Fi and a business centre. Packed lunches are provided for those heading off to explore the area.
Foundry 34 has 7 rooms, all of which are fitted with a hair dryer.
Foundry 34 has an on-site restaurant, perfect for guests wishing to eat in. Alternatively, there are plenty of dining options in close proximity.
Foundry 34 is an ideal base to explore nearby Ullswater and Lake District National Park. It is also an easy drive from Carlisle and Keswick.
